From a024ffceb44853f7f4bebe70095f61903a715a5b Mon Sep 17 00:00:00 2001 From: sys4 Date: Sun, 29 Dec 2019 17:11:04 +0100 Subject: [PATCH] =?UTF-8?q?Corrige=20la=20mise=20=C3=A0=20jour=20du=20serv?= =?UTF-8?q?eur=20quand=20on=20garde=20l'ancienne=20map?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.dir-locals.el | 14 ++++++++++---- install.sh | 16 ++++++++++++---- minetest-dev.conf | 2 -- 3 files changed, 22 insertions(+), 10 deletions(-) mode change 100755 => 100644 .dir-locals.el diff --git a/.dir-locals.el b/.dir-locals.el old mode 100755 new mode 100644 index f48b159..72ae150 --- a/.dir-locals.el +++ b/.dir-locals.el @@ -1,4 +1,10 @@ -((nil . ((indent-tabs-mode . t) - (tab-width . 3))) - (lua-mode . ( - (eval . (highlight-regexp "^ *"))))) +;;; Directory Local Variables +;;; For more information see (info "(emacs) Directory Variables") + +((lua-mode + (fill-column . 80) + (tab-width . 3) + (indent-tabs-mode . t))) + + + diff --git a/install.sh b/install.sh index 0ae35fe..6797b1d 100755 --- a/install.sh +++ b/install.sh @@ -172,7 +172,7 @@ install_minetest_game() { install_mods() { if [[ -d nalc-server-mods ]]; then echo "Le dossier de mods est déjà présent. Que souhaitez-vous faire ?" - read -p "Choisissez parmi la liste, ([1]update, [2]clean, [3]cancel, [4]Ne rien faire) : " continue + read -p "Choisissez parmi la liste, ([1]update, [2]clean update, [3]cancel, [4]Ne rien faire) : " continue if [[ $continue == 1 ]]; then ./upgrade.sh -m elif [[ $continue == 2 ]]; then @@ -214,17 +214,25 @@ install_world() { fi if [[ -d minetest/worlds/$world_name ]]; then echo "Une map est déjà présente. Que souhaitez-vous faire ?" - read -p "Choisissez parmi la liste ([1]Nouveau, [2]Utiliser) : " continuer + read -p "Choisissez parmi la liste ([1]Nouveau, [2]Mettre à jour [3]Ne rien faire) : " continuer if [[ $continuer == 1 ]]; then if [[ -n $pg_dbname ]]; then read -p "Les BDD $pg_dbname et players-$pg_dbname ne seront pas effacées. À vous de le faire manuellement après ce script ! -- Press enter -- : " continuer fi - + # On sauvegarde l'ancien world if [[ -d "minetest/worlds/"$world_name"_old" ]]; then rm -rf "minetest/worlds/"$world_name"_old" fi - mv minetest/worlds/$world_name "minetest/worlds/"$world_name"_old" + elif [[ $continuer == 2 ]]; then + # On sauvegarde l'ancien world + if [[ -d "minetest/worlds/"$world_name"_old" ]]; then + rm -rf "minetest/worlds/"$world_name"_old" + fi + cp -r minetest/worlds/$world_name "minetest/worlds/"$world_name"_old" + + # On met à jour les fichiers contenues dans cette map + ./upgrade.sh -w $world_name -b $ver fi fi diff --git a/minetest-dev.conf b/minetest-dev.conf index fb9027d..45c20eb 100644 --- a/minetest-dev.conf +++ b/minetest-dev.conf @@ -148,8 +148,6 @@ give_initial_stuff = true initial_stuff = "default:axe_wood 1,default:torch 10,default:sapling 2,default:apple 5" # AREAS MOD areas.self_protection = true -areas.self_protection_max_size = {x=128, y=128, z=128} -areas.self_protection_max_areas = 30 # MOBS remove_far_mobs = true mobs_spawn_protected = false